Now I'm not suggesting you rip up your bathroom tiles and throw up a rainbow of colors, but adding a splash of color here and there couldn't hurt. Maybe pull out those colorful hand towels you keep for summer time, get some bright little accessories, change up the shower curtain to one with a punch of color or add some bright soaps with tropical scents. Anything to add some brightness and liveliness to bring in the feeling of summer and sunshine and put a bounce in your step before you have to bundle yourself up in scarves and tuques.
